Texas AG Ken Paxton announces $1.4 billion settlement from Meta over biometric data capture

Texas Attorney General Ken Paxton hopes his $1.4 billion settlement with Meta over its unauthorized biometric data capture sends a big message to other technology companies. “You have to hit [Big Tech] with a lot of money fines or it doesn’t matter to them. They just figure it’s the cost of doing business,” he says.
